“Best staff experience ever”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ed 14 February 2011

A friend of mine and I stayed at Goldminer's Daughter last week for four nights and it was great. Very convenient location right next to the Collins lift, and good food at the inclusive breakfast and dinner. Also enjoyed the indoor hot tub, game room, and spa for a massage. The staff was the friendlest I've ever experienced, always willing to help with a caring attitude. Some other posts complain about the room you get for the money, but for a ski in/out, $350/night for a double including breakfast and dinner is good. If you find something better in Alta for less let me know!

“skier's delight and great hospitality”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 9 February 2011

just back from 4 day/4 night stay at GMD. Arrived on Monday (1/31) to 18" of fresh powder. GMD is PERFECT for the skier who is looking to ski a great mountain. First time to Alta and I love this place. High Traverse, Alf's Rustler, Supreme Chair are all great runs. The staff at GMD are great people, very friendly. Food was delicious. We had 6 degrees of separation our entire trip as we met new friends with close connections to existing friends. Karaoke night on Monday was a riot (the "Ticks" song).
Will be back.

“Some things never change...”
3 of 5 stars Reviewed 11 May 2010

And that's a good thing. We're serious skiiers and we don't need a lot of fussy creature comforts. GMD provides the basics for expert skiiers who need to be close to the lifts, lots of rest and good, simple food. It's not about the hotel, it's all about the mountain. And GMD rises to that occasion. Regulars like us are treated like family or old friends. The decor hasn't changed since the seventies and we don't feel like we're paying for a lot of chinzy eye candy. We need a good massage, maybe a sauna, simple food and a good night's sleep. GMD delivers everytime because they've got a time tested formula for delivering the basics at a reasonable price. I'm reluctant to write this review because it may cause GMD to be sold-out when we want to book at the last minute.

“LOVE GOLDMINER'S!!!”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ed 30 March 2010

Goldminer's was the perfect place to stay and ski at Alta. My dad and I absolutely love to ski and Goldminer's is the ideal lodge for people like us - those who want to get up, ski all day, effortlessly walk the few steps back to the room, and relax. The location is perfect, and the lodge has a ski shop downstairs, plus ski lockers so the whole ski-in/ski-out process is simple. One of the best parts of the lodge is the food - breakfast buffet with made-to-order omelets and fabulous pancakes! Afternoon tea and dinner are also delicious and we met some really interesting and nice people at one of the communal dinner tables one night (they also have private tables). The rooms are spacious - ours had a nice view of the snowfall. All the employees (especially the waiters at the restaurant) were extremely friendly and helpful. They remembered us night after night and gave my dad great advice about a shin injury. The staff are all very young and enthusiastic about their jobs. One disappointment was that the hot tubs were closed, and not likely to be available for a while. Overall, I loved Goldminer's and can't wait to return as soon as possible!!
